Covariant formulation of relativistic Hamiltonian theory on the light cone

N. M. Atakishiyev, R. M. Mir-Kassimov, Sh. M. Nagiyev


Abstract: In the covariant formulation of relativistic hamiltonian theory given in [1–3] the momenta of all physical particles belong to the mass shell. In the vertices of diagrams the total 4-momentum of physical particles and the additional spurion line is conserved. The momentum of the spurion is proportional to the constant time-like vector on which the on-shell $S$-matrix does not depend. In the present paper a version of relativistic hamiltonian theory is developed in which the 4-momentum of the spurion lies on the light cone. Essentially new point in this scheme is a specific regularisation, by means of which the singularities present in all theories formulated in the light cone variables are removed in all diagrams. The unitarity and causality conditions are analysed in detail. It is shown that the choice of the regularisation is determined by the causality condition.
